Estimates the risk of stroke after a suspected transient ischemic attack (TIA)
Component | Criteria | Points |
Age | ≥ 60 years | 1 |
< 60 years | 0 | |
Blood Pressure | Systolic ≥ 140 mmHg or Diastolic ≥ 90 mmHg | 1 |
Systolic < 140 mmHg and Diastolic < 90 mmHg | 0 | |
Clinical features | Unilateral weakness | 2 |
Speech disturbance without weakness | 1 | |
Other symptoms | 0 | |
Duration | ≥ 60 minutes | 2 |
10-59 minutes | 1 | |
< 10 minutes | 0 | |
Diabetes | Present | 1 |
Absent | 0 |
Scoring Interpretation:
A. 0-3 points: Low risk of stroke (approximately 1% risk within 2 days)
B. 4-5 points: Moderate risk of stroke (approximately 4% risk within 2 days)
C. 6-7 points: High risk of stroke (approximately 8% risk within 2 days)
